Ludwigia x taiwanensis Peng in Bot. Bull. Acad. Sin. 31: 344. fig. 5. 1990. Holotype: Taiwan, Taoyuan, Lungtan, Peng 7215 (HAST; isotypes: CAS, GH, HAST, K, MO, TI, US). Gu, Chen, Liu, Qu & Pan in Cathaya 3: 40. 1991.

    Perennial herb with creeping or floating stems, to 60 cm long, rooting freely at nodes, sometimes with white, upward, spindle-shaped aerophores arising in clusters at the node of the floating stem; stems glabrous, branched, the tips ascending. Leaves narrowly elliptic to spatulate-oblong, 0.7-9.5 cm long, 0.4-2.7 cm wide, glabrous, the apex rounded or obtuse, margin entire, base narrowly cuneate or attenuate, the petioles 5-30 mm long. Flowers in leaf axils of ascending stems. Bracteoles deltoid, in pairs near the base of the ovary. Sepals 5, narrowly triangular- lanceolate, deciduous, 8-12 mm long, 1.6-2.5 mm wide, glabrous to hirtellous. Petals 5, pale yellow, broadly obovate, apex truncate or obtuse, sometimes semi-unfolded, base attenuate, 13- 18 mm long, 9-12 mm wide. Stamens 10, antesepalous stamens alternating with slightly shorter antepetalous stamens; anthers indehiscent or barely dehiscent, extrorse, 1.3-1.8 mm long, filaments 2-3.5 mm long. Pollen grains nearly always aborted, shriveled and unstainable. Disc with 5 depressed, V-shaped nectaries each fringed with dense, villous hairs. Style 5-7 mm long, glabrous; stigma discoid. Mature capsules lacking. 2 n= 24. Flowers May-Dec.

    A natural triploid hybrid species between Ludwigia adscendens (L.) Hara, a tetraploid, and L. peploides (Kunth) Raven ssp. stipulacea (Ohwi) Raven, a diploid; the latter taxon does not occur in Taiwan. Widely distributed in southern China and throughout the lowlands of Taiwan, forming pure stands or mixed with other aquatic weeds in drainage ditches, fallow and wet paddies, along river banks, about waste swampy grounds and the borders of fish ponds or reservoirs.
